Abstract

An electronic device includes one or more low-power context sensors, one or more high-power context sensors, and one or more processors operable with the one or more low-power context sensors and the one or more high-power context sensors. The one or more processors, working with context engines associated with the sensors, minimize usage of the high-power context sensors when determining a context of the electronic device, where that determined context has a confidence score above a predefined confidence level threshold.
